Common Causes of OS Updates Disrupting Car Connectivity
Mercedes smartphone integration systems, while advanced and convenient, can sometimes experience disruptions after operating system (OS) updates. Common causes behind this issue include compatibility problems between the updated OS and the vehicle’s infotainment software, as well as potential glitches in the communication protocols between the smartphone and the car’s onboard computer. Additionally, changes in API (Application Programming Interface) structures used by the OS can lead to connectivity issues, rendering the seamless integration that Mercedes vehicles are known for unavailable.
These disruptions may manifest as difficulties pairing devices, loss of data connection, or even a complete failure to recognize the smartphone. Users might find themselves unable to access essential apps like navigation, call handling, or music streaming services.
